Putting on an Exhibition



After producing so much work, it would be ideal to take some time to plan an exhibition. An exhibition is a time to make things public, set up a space in the school and bring work made throughout the project. Set a date and send invitations to parents and the other classes of the school.
Give children agency to plan this exhibition, move furniture out of the room, hang works properly on the wall, take a full day to set this exhibition up. Write texts for the artworks, make a map of the room and write titles for the works, you could even designate tour guides.
The idea is to create a sense of autonomy, pride and care for the work produced. Make sure the children present their notebooks on the day!
